Форум: "Основная";
Текущий архив: 2004.09.05;
Скачать: [xml.tar.bz2];
ВнизИзменение цвета строки StringGrid Найти похожие ветки
← →
Марат (2004-08-23 09:10) [0]Здравствуйте, мастера. Нашел в Интернете свойство StringGridDrawCell:
procedure TForm1.StringGrid1DrawCell(Sender: TObject; ACol, ARow: Integer;
Rect: TRect; State: TGridDrawState);
begin
With TStringGrid(Sender),TStringGrid(Sender).Canvas Do
Begin
FillRect(Rect);
Font.Color:=ClBlue; // цвет шрифта
TextOut(Rect.Left+2,Rect.Top+2,Cells[ACol,ARow]);
End;
end;
Но мне нужно чтобы это случилось при условии strtodatetime(StringGrid.Cells[1,i])<strtodatetime(StringGrid.Cells[3,i]), а как прописать такое условие в данном случае я не знаю. Помогите, пожалуйста.
← →
Думкин © (2004-08-23 09:17) [1]
if strtodatetime(StringGrid.Cells[1,ARow])<strtodatetime(StringGrid.Cells[3,ARow]) then begin
end
← →
Марат (2004-08-23 09:22) [2]А как исключить ARow=0. Это у меня заголовок.
← →
Рамиль © (2004-08-23 09:24) [3]Да...
if (ARow > 0) and (strtodatetime(StringGrid.Cells[1,ARow])<strtodatetime(StringGrid.Cells[3,ARow])) then begin
end
Страницы: 1 вся ветка
Форум: "Основная";
Текущий архив: 2004.09.05;
Скачать: [xml.tar.bz2];
Память: 0.44 MB
Время: 0.045 c